Army List: 1000 pts of Orks

This is (unless I change my mind...again!) The list I will be playing with next week:

Warboss - Mega Armour, Attack Squig, Cybork Body, boss pole. = 130 pts

5 Nobs, 'Eavy Armour, 1 Power Klaw, 4 Big choppas, 5 Twin-linked Shootas, Waaagh Banner = 210 pts

1 Looted Tank, 2 rokkit launchas, red paint job. grot riggers, reinforced ram = 70 pts

30 shoota Boyz, 3 big shootas, Nob with Powerklaw+Boss pole, 'Eavy armor, shoota = 240 pts

2 Big gunz, Lobbas = 50 pts

Dakkajet, additional twin-linked supah shoota, flyboss, red paint job  =135

11 lootas - mek boy  = 165

1000 pts



As usual, my warboss and nobs go in the looted tank. The warboss got mega armour this time, I usually just go 'eavy armor and cybork body, and it's usually enough. But because of that Blood Angel librarian and his force staff I'm upgrading to lower chances of getting insta-killed.
The Nobs get some new gear as well, I usually just run all with 'eavy armour and one nob with a PK. This time they all get twin-linked shootas, and Big choppas (except the PK guy, he's solid). This will give them more firepower before an assault or in case they get assaulted somewhere down the line. And because the Warboss also has a twin-linked shoota, it'll be 12 s4 shots with re-rolls before the charge, that should put a tiny dent into whatever the target is. Especially if it's not MEQ's (marine equivalent).
They get one less attack in close combat though, so I might as well get em a big choppa then to make up for it. And a Waaagh-banner for +1 ws. On the charge with 5 nobs it'll still be 16 ws5, s7 attacks and 4 more which are ap2 and s9! And then you add the warboss to that mix with 6 attacks on the charge, ws6 because of the Waaagh-banner, s10, ap2 and they should chew through anything really. Heck I should win most challenges as well (I'm looking at you, Librarian!).

the Looted Tank got a slew of upgrades because I had a few points to spare. Normally I just give it two big shootas for fire support, and maybe a reinforced ram in case I need to go through terrain or 'Don't press dat' and involuntary go through it. This time I gave it 2 rokkits which could almost be better becaue the 2 big shootas normally don't do much, and this might at least take out an extra marine, or I could try to pop a tank or a transport to help my warboss out before an assault. Red paint job is nice because you really want to get stuck in, grot riggers can also help getting things moving again, unless it gets blown up first. Too bad it can't repair and start moving in the same turn...

I went full Waaagh-tard and brought 30 boyz this time, all with shootas and 3 big shootas for even more dakka, the Nob even got 'eavy armour because, again, I had points to spare. 

I'm also finally gonna try out the Lobbas, I read Ork Big Gunz are pretty good at lower points battles, and I'm generally just hoping for some fun with these guys. 

I was gonna try out another flyer, like the burna bomma, but since it's very anti (light) infantry focused, and everything else is as well... I'm gonna try it out some other time. Instead I brought the Dakkajet again, it's way more reliable, even if it only has s6 shots. (the other two planes can't even match that!)

11 lootas with a mek (10 lootas, 1 mek), for that 5+ cover save mostly. which is nice if you can't get it from the terrain in your deployment zone, and even if you can this just gives you some more freedom in the placement. I'm also a fan of the kustom mega-blasta, it's just too bad it doesn't have the same range as a Deff gun. but if thing get too close the lootas get to pack some extra punch to scare the enemy off with at least.

My Ork army, so far!


A snapped a couple of pictures before the latest battle of my entire army of Orks so far and this is what I got!



One of the earliest thing I got was Killa kans because they're super cool  and have ballistic skill 3, wohoo!
with AV 11 they're actually pretty good as the enemy has to direct its heavier weaponry towards them to bring them down, they only have two hull points each, but as there's three of them and they cost about 45-55 points each and roll in a walker squadron so it's really like having 6 hp... kind of!
despite only having weapon skill 2, they still hit on 4+ against most things, and do have strength 5 (x2 because they have dreadnought close combat weapons) and ap 2, so they're actually good to get stuck in with against some targets, especially if it's a unit that can't hurt them in melee (anything below strength 5!)


There's the good ol' looted tank that I bring as a transport for my warboss and nob bodyguard. I mainly picked it over a trukk because of AV 11 instead of 10, meaning measly bolter fire and the like can't glance it to death, it can also be kitted out with a boom gun if I feel like foot slogging my warlord and nuking stuff with the tank instead.
I have about 8-10 nobs and a pain boy but I usually just run 8 nobs with 'eavy armor, a skorcha/shoota kombi-weapon, one with a powerklaw to give it some more bite, and sometimes a whaaag banner because having a silly large amount of attacks hitting on 3+ and 3+ again on the charge (against MEQ) is pretty brutal, and then you add the powerklaw after that for mop up.
My warboss almost always have cybork body, 'eavy armor, a skorcha/shoota, powerklaw, attack squid and a boss pole. Sometimes I give him mega armour if I feel he needs it. which he will do against that pesky force staff... my tactic with these guys are simple. drive them up, lol at Don't press dat, jump out, fire the skorchas to kill stuff and then charge in and trample everything! WAAAAAGH!

I recently got a Wierdboy because psychic powers are fun, and even more so when they're random. Very Orky! I mainly wanted him to boost my army some and maybe give me a random Waaagh here and there, which can be super useful once my Dakkajet is out because it makes it fire twice as many shots.


I also have 10 lootas for fire support, very useful for dwindling down enemy units or taking out large targets and flyers, I don't ever NOT bring them because they're amazeballs.
I got 10 burnas that desperatly need a transport right now. they're kinda meh because of their small number and high cost, but right now they get to be the Wierdboyz bodyguard, their ability to turn their burnas to ap3 power weapons is nifty, so with the wierdboy they either get some ranged firepower from him, maybe a +1 attack or they could even get to deep strike mid mission. Could be good.

I have about 30 regular boyz, I usually run them on about 20 with a nob (powerklaw + bosspole is a must)

I got (so far) only 3 Ork warbikers, but I still love these guys. A bigger unit would be pretty great, altough kind of expensive, as these three, one of them being a powerklaw toting nob, cost almost as much as my Dakkajet!

I also just custom made two Big gunz. two Lobbas to be precise, but ironically enough I've only played them as kannons. because they have higher strength and ap, and are cheaper. But I will definitly run them someday as I meant to, as lobbas.

Last but not least (because I have a Blood Axe army), I have 10 Kommandos, with my home made Snikrot leading them. They're not that super great, but because of snikrot they're a good threat to enemy units who want to hang back, and because Snikrot is base strength 5 with around 5-6 attacks, and strength 6 on the charge, he can actually hurt tanks! and I always bring to kommandos with burnas, for either template use or power weapon support if they run into something nasty.
